Minutes
May 15, 2024
A regular meeting of the Board of City Commissioners was held on May 15, 2024, at 7:00 p.m. at the City
Meeting Room. Present Commissioners John Clausen, Jim Schacher and President LeeAnn Domonoske-
Kellar.
Motion made by Schacher and seconded by Clausen to approve the minutes from the Board of
Equalization meeting held on May 1, 2024 as presented. All present voted aye, motion carried.
Motion made by Clausen and seconded by Schacher to approve the minutes from the May 1, 2024
meeting as presented. All present voted aye, motion carried.
Motion made by Clausen and seconded by Schacher to approve the agenda as presented. All present
voted aye, motion carried.
Motion made by Clausen and seconded by Schacher to approve the seconded reading and final passage
of ordinance 8.0603 – License Required and 8.0632 – Special Event Permits Winery and Microbrewery.
All present voted aye, motion carried.
Motion made by Schacher and seconded by Clausen to approve the change order for the 2022/2023
Improvement Project as presented by Moore Engineering. All present voted aye, motion carried.
Motion made by Schacher and seconded by Clausen to approve a budget amendment to the
2022/2023 Improvement Project budget. All present voted aye, motion carried. There is no change in
the overall cost of the project, funds are being moved between budget line items.
Motion made by Schacher and seconded by Clausen to approve the Resolution of Governing Body of
Applicant. All present voted aye, motion carried. The resolution is to apply for State Revolving Funds for
the 2023 Improvement Project.
Motion made by Schacher and seconded by Clausen to approve the bid from Phoenix Construction to
put a sloped roof on the Memorial Hall for $73,000. All present voted aye, motion carried. The funds
will be requested from the Sales and Use Tax Board.
Motion made by Clausen and seconded by Schacher to approve the request from CREA to use the
Memorial Hall for the Wilton Summer program for $100 per week. All present voted aye, motion
carried. The Wilton Summer Program is normally held at the Wilton School but due to construction at
the school, the program had to relocate.
Motion made by Schacher and seconded by Clausen to approve the first reading of the Floodplain
Management ordinance. All present voted aye, motion carried.
Motion made by Schacher and seconded by Clausen to join Strengthen ND. All present voted aye,
motion carried. Strengthen ND will aid the City in applying for grants.
Pres. Domonoske-Kellar asked the Commissioner to bring a list of items or projects to budget for in
2025.
Motion made by Clausen and seconded by Schacher to pay bills as presented. Roll call vote. Aye:
Comm. Clausen, Schacher and Pres. Domonoske-Kellar. Absent: Comm. Kary and Hedstrom. Motion
carried.
With no other items for discussion, Pres. Domonoske-Kellar declared the meeting adjourned at 7:52
p.m.
